485,160. Portable conveyers. GEWERKSCHAFT EISENHUTTE WESTFALIA. Nov. 9, 1936, Nos. 30567, 30568, 30569, 30570, 30571, and 30572. Convention dates, Nov. 8, 1935, Nov. 16, 1935, Nov. 16, 1935, Nov. 16, 1935, Nov. 16, 1935, and Dec. 27, 1935. [Classes 78 (i) and 78 (ii)] A loading machine, particularly for use in coal mines, having a scoop or shovel 10 at the front and a conveyer 15 by which the material to be loaded is carried from the scoop rearwards and discharged over the end 14 into tubs, is advanced into the brokendown material by haulage on a rope or chain 18 anchored at the front, the arrangement being characterized by the feature that the point of anchorage 20, the front edge of the scoop and the point of engagement of the rope or chain with a guide pulley or drum 31 on the machine all lie in the same horizontal or substantially horizontal plane. The scoop 10 and the rearwardly extending conveyercarrying arm 13 are bolted to the central body part 11 of the machine by means of flanges 45 to allow of detachment for passage down mine shafts. The body 11 is pivoted to a wheeled undercarriage 29 about a transverse axis 28 coinciding with the axis of the guide pulley 31, being adjustable thereabout, by means of a screwbolt 30 or a pinion and toothed segment, to raise or lower the scoop. By such adjustment, the front wheels 27 may be raised off the rails when the machine is in action so that the scoop bears on the ground, an adjustable skid 44 being provided under the scoop to prevent it digging into the ground. The anchored hauling rope 18, passing round the guide drum 31, is connected to a winding drum 22 driven by ratchet gearing which may comprise a driving pawl 23 eccentrically mounted on a shaft 52 driven through a worm wheel and worm shaft 51 from a motor 33 which also drives the conveyer hand 15 and a supplementary winding drum 25. The rope 26 from the drum 25 may be used for drawing the machine along under its own power until it approaches the working face, being, for this purpose, anchored to pit props or other fixed points ahead of the machine. When the machine is in use, the rope 26 may be led over overhead pulleys and utilized to draw away the tubs as they are loaded. During these operations, the driving pawl 23 and also a holding detent 37 may be held out of action by catches 38, 381. The pawls may also be withdrawn to allow the conveyer to carry away an accumulation of material on the scoop. Alternatively, the driving pawl may be operated by a compressed air motor which ceases to drive on meeting excessive resistance. The front of the scoop is considerably wider than the conveyer band, the sides narrowing towards the rear and sloping inwards towards the band, Fig. 7. The machine may be provided with a buffer 24. The Specification as open to inspection under Sect. 91, comprises also means for transferring the loading machine or the tubs from one set of rails to an adjacent set, and alternative means for advancing the machine into the broken-down material. Transfer of the loading machine is effected by raising it and then lowering it on to a pair of wheeled carriages 401 riding in channel beams 39 placed across the tracks, Fig. 10 (Cancelled). The tubs may be transferred by traversing means of known type, connected by chains to a bar projecting laterally from the loading machine, or by a turning plate. The buffer 24 may comprise a piston and be utilized either for propelling the tubs or, by engagement with a braked or chocked tub, for pushing the loading machine towards the working face. This subject-matter does not appear in the Specification as accepted.
